Full Job Description
Tsunami Tsolutions is seeking a Quality & Continuous Improvement Manager to lead our Quality Management System while driving operational excellence across both our internal operations and customer engagements.

This role combines traditional Quality Management responsibilities with business process improvement leadership. Approximately half of the role focuses on maintaining and advancing our AS9100-certified Quality Management System, while the other half focuses on identifying, facilitating, and implementing business process improvements using Lean, Six Sigma, Value Stream Mapping, and related methodologies.

The ideal candidate is equally comfortable facilitating an AS9100 audit, leading a value stream mapping workshop, coaching employees on process improvement techniques, and helping customers identify opportunities to improve performance.

This is a highly visible role that works across all areas of the business and has the opportunity to influence both company operations and customer success.

Quality Management Leadership
• Serve as the designated AS9100 Management Representative.
• Represent Quality within the Operations Leadership Group (OLG).
• Maintain and continually improve the company's Quality Management System (QMS).
• Ensure ongoing compliance with AS9100 and customer-specific quality requirements.
• Monitor QMS effectiveness through metrics, audits, corrective actions, and management reviews.
• Own and oversee Quality processes including NCRs, CARs, Root Cause Analysis, and continual improvement activities.
• Serve as the internal Quality subject matter expert and advisor.
Audit & Compliance Management
• Plan, coordinate, and facilitate internal audits.
• Lead external audits including AS9100 certification audits and customer audits.
• Track findings and corrective actions through closure.
• Prepare audit reports and communicate results to leadership.
• Ensure organizational readiness for customer and certification audits.
Continuous Improvement & Operational Excellence
• Lead business process improvement initiatives across the organization.
• Facilitate Value Stream Mapping (VSM) workshops and process reviews.
• Identify waste, bottlenecks, inefficiencies, and opportunities for improvement.
• Apply Lean, Six Sigma, Kaizen, Root Cause Analysis, and other improvement methodologies.
• Establish and track process performance metrics and improvement initiatives.
• Partner with functional leaders to prioritize and execute improvement projects.
• Develop sustainable systems for measuring and improving organizational performance.
